HELLO FROM THE PRINCIPAL!
Dear Parents/Caregivers,
This term has flown by and we now find ourselves with two weeks holiday before the very busy last term for 2014. Next term, in Week 4 we welcome a team from the Education Review Office, who will spend the week with us and give us valuable feedback about our school, in comparison to other New Zealand schools. We are looking forward to having them with us and will be looking for parents to speak to them about the experience families have had at our school.
We had hoped to commence our Walk and Wheel Travelwise program, with children being dropped off at Wairere from the first day of next term, but we have not as yet received the support items to kick this off. Please keep an eye out on your school App and our website and Facebook page, for information about this launch going ahead on the first day of term.
Further on in this newsletter, is evidence of our staff vs students netball game which took place at lunchtime. I would like to say the staff were victorious. I would like to say it, but sadly, I don’t think that would be accurate. The only positive I can find from the thrashing the staff took, was that our PE program must be excellent to produce skills like that!! (or our staff are getting old and unfit???)
Also today, was the PTA/GST sausage sizzle. Thanks so much to everyone that supported this and thanks to the ladies who cooked and organised this for us.
So, for the next two weeks, enjoy having your children home with you and have a safe and happy holiday.

PLANNING FOR 2015:It is at this stage of the year we begin to look at numbers for the next year. Knowing how many children we are likely to have enrolled in 2015 impacts on staffing and the number of classes we are likely to have at each level and we like to begin the planning process as early as possible.
If you know that you child(ren) will NOT be returning to The Gardens School in 2015, please let us know. Likewise, if you have a pre-‐schooler who is turning 5 in 2015, we would also like to know this informa7on. Please email [email protected]
